Water damage mitigation services involve identifying and addressing issues caused by excess moisture in a property. When water intrusion occurs due to leaks, flooding, or plumbing failures, these professionals work to remove standing water, dry affected areas, and prevent further damage. The process often includes extracting water, using specialized equipment to dry out walls, floors, and other structures, and applying treatments to inhibit mold growth. This comprehensive approach aims to restore the property’s integrity and reduce the risk of long-term problems caused by moisture.

These services help solve a variety of problems associated with water intrusion. Common issues include warped flooring, stained walls, mold growth, and structural weakening. Water damage can also lead to unpleasant odors and potential health hazards if not addressed promptly. Local contractors can assess the extent of the damage, develop a tailored mitigation plan, and implement effective solutions to minimize the impact of water-related incidents, whether they stem from natural flooding, burst pipes, or appliance leaks.

The overview below groups typical Water Damage Mitigation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Johnstown, PA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or water damage mitigation in Johnstown, PA often range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s, such as small leak repairs or localized drying,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ects reach the higher end, which may involve more extensive cleanup or repairs.

Moderate Projects - Medium-sized mitigation efforts, including partial structural drying or mold remediation, usually cost between $600 and $2,000. These projects are common for homes experiencing moderate water intrusion and require more comprehensive work by local contractors.

Large-Scale Mitigation - Larger, more complex water damage projects, such as significant flooding cleanup or extensive structural drying, can range from $2,000 to $5,000. Such jobs are less frequent but often involve multiple areas or prolonged work by service providers.

Full Replacement or Major Repairs - Complete water-damaged area replacements, including drywall, flooring, and insulation, typically exceed $5,000 and can reach higher costs depending on the scope. These extensive projects are less common and usually involve significant structural or property damage.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When selecting a water damage mitigation service provider in Johnstown, PA,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about the types of water damage they have handled and whether they have worked on properties comparable to their own. An experienced contractor will be familiar with the specific challenges that can arise during water mitigation and will be better equipped to develop an effective plan to restore the home efficiently and thoroughly.

Clear, written expectations are essential when working with local contractors. Homeowners should seek providers who can offer detailed descriptions of the scope of work, the steps involved in the mitigation process, and any materials or methods that will be used. Having these details in writing helps ensure everyone is aligned on what to expect and can prevent misunderstandings during the project. It’s also helpful to ask for a written outline of the process to review before work begins.

Reputable references and strong communication are key indicators of a reliable water damage mitigation service. Homeowners should ask potential service providers for references from past clients who had similar projects completed. Speaking with previous customers can provide insights into the contractor’s professionalism, quality of work, and reliability. Good communication throughout the process-such as timely responses to questions and clear updates-also helps ensure the project proceeds smoothly. These qualities contribute to a positive experience and confidence in the chosen service provider.
